Frequently Asked Questions
My lawn in Pine Grove Mills feels thin and compacted. Is this common for homes built around 1986?
Yes, soil maturity is a key factor. A 40-year-old lot has soil that has settled and lost organic structure. In Ferguson's acidic Hagerstown silt loam, compaction from decades of foot traffic and mowing reduces percolation. Core aeration and adding composted organic matter are critical to restore soil health and support your turf's root zone.
Should I use wood or stone for a new patio that lasts?
Pennsylvania Bluestone offers superior longevity and lower maintenance than wood, which decays and requires chemical treatments. In Ferguson's Moderate Fire Wise rating (WUI Zone 2), non-combustible stone also contributes to defensible space. A properly installed bluestone patio adds permanent value without the recurring upkeep of wooden structures.
My yard pools water after heavy rain. What's a lasting solution for this soil?
Moderate runoff is common in our clay-heavy subsoil with low permeability. Solutions include installing French drains or dry creek beds to redirect water. For patios or walkways, using permeable Pennsylvania Bluestone set on a gravel base can meet Ferguson Township Planning and Zoning Department's stormwater runoff standards by allowing infiltration.

Is there a lower-maintenance alternative to my high-input lawn?
Transitioning sections to a native plant palette is recommended. Species like Eastern Redbud, Wild Bergamot, New England Aster, and Switchgrass are adapted to Zone 6b and acidic soils, requiring less water and no chemical inputs. This approach also future-proofs your property against tightening noise ordinances that will restrict gas-powered blowers.
Should I water my Kentucky Bluegrass daily, and is it allowed under current restrictions?
Ferguson is in Stage 0 with no municipal restrictions, but ecologically sound practice is to use ET-based irrigation. Wi-Fi weather-sensing controllers apply water only when evapotranspiration data indicates a deficit. This method conserves water, prevents runoff on clay-heavy subsoil, and maintains turf health by encouraging deeper root growth.
I see invasive vines taking over my shrubs. How do I handle this safely?
Common invasives like English Ivy or Japanese Honeysuckle must be managed carefully. Manual removal is preferred for small areas. For larger infestations, targeted herbicide application by a Pennsylvania Department of Agriculture certified applicator ensures compliance with the PA Nutrient Management Act, avoiding application during blackout dates to protect watersheds.
What permits do I need to regrade and reshape my 0.45-acre yard?
Significant earthmoving on a lot this size typically requires an erosion and sedimentation control plan approved by the Ferguson Township Planning and Zoning Department. The work must be performed by a contractor licensed for grading, as improper grading can affect drainage on adjacent properties. Always verify current licensing with the Pennsylvania Department of Agriculture for any pesticide or soil amendment applications involved.
